EULA reapears after streaming the disk to another machine with Citrix Provisioning Services

New Here ,
Jul 04, 2012 Jul 04, 2012

We have a Citrix Xenapp 6.5 farm and we use Citrix provisioning services to stream 1 disk to multiple servers in the farm.

We use Adobe acrobat professional X and the EULA pop-ups keeps appearing for each user. During the installation of the master image the ACCEPT_EULA property is set to "yes"

The only way to get rid of these popups is to unistall acrobat and re-install it.

Is this the only way to fix this or is there a quicker method, script or registry entry or whatever to fix this issue?

How are you setting the property? Is it command line or via the Wizard?

  • If CMD, then get the Admin Guide and double check your syntax.
  • If Wizard, verify the property is set by inspecting the UI and the installer tables with the Direct Editor.

Post back.
